Chemical & Physical Properties

[ Density]:
1.342g/cm3

[ Boiling Point ]:
306.4ºC at 760mmHg

[ Melting Point ]:
144-146ºC(lit.)

[ Molecular Formula ]:
C7H12O5

[ Molecular Weight ]:
176.16700

[ Flash Point ]:
153.3ºC

[ Exact Mass ]:
176.06800

[ PSA ]:
94.83000
